Spending and revenue data obtained for this analysis comes from the Illinois Local Education Agency Retrieval Network (ILEARN), which is part of the Illinois State Board of Education and collects data annually on school district financials.
Over the 10-year span, Wabash CUSD 348 reported 0.7 percent more revenue. At the same time, total spending went up 7.9 percent.
